OpCodes.Arglist Pole
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Vrátí nespravovaný ukazatel na seznam argumentů aktuální metody.
public: static initonly System::Reflection::Emit::OpCode Arglist;
public static readonly System.Reflection.Emit.OpCode Arglist;
staticval mutable Arglist : System.Reflection.Emit.OpCode
Public Shared ReadOnly Arglist As OpCode
Hodnota pole
Poznámky
Následující tabulka uvádí hexadecimální formát sestavení instrukce a formát sestavení MSIL (Microsoft Intermediate Language) spolu se stručným souhrnem referenčních informací:
Formát | Formát sestavení | Description |
---|---|---|
FE 00 | arglist | Vrátí popisovač seznamu argumentů pro aktuální metodu. |
Tato operace neprovádí žádné chování zásobníku vyhodnocení.
Instrukce arglist
vrátí neprůkazný popisovač (nespravovaný ukazatel typu native int
), který představuje seznam argumentů aktuální metody. Tento popisovač je platný pouze po dobu životnosti aktuální metody. Můžete však předat popisovač jiným metodám, pokud je aktuální metoda ve vlákně ovládacího prvku. Instrukce můžete spustit arglist
pouze v rámci metody, která přijímá proměnlivý počet argumentů.
Následující Emit přetížení metody může použít arglist
opcode: